Hey guys, I have a question about backing up the songs on my iPod.


I have about 900 songs that I do not want to lose, the only place they exist is on the iPod itself (they were deleted from the external HD they were stored on). iTunes doesn't allow you to copy songs from the device to a HD, so my question is, is there any software out there that will allow me to do this?


I'm always prone to sporadic HD corrption on my iPod (it's happened to 3 different ones). Since my old music library has been deleted, I want a way to back up everything that I still have on my player.

With a third party program like this one :

http://www.jakeludington.com/downloads/20050420_ipod_access_for_windows.html

This program also says it can copy music from corrupted files and it has a free trial period so you don't have to buy it if it won't work for you.

For the rest, I guess you now know about burning the songs to disk (DVD or CD) as well as using an external hard drive.
